Is a Double-Breasted Jacket Slimming?
Yes, a well-tailored double-breasted jacket can have a slimming effect. The key is in the cut and the positioning of the buttons, which can create a cinched waistline illusion, emphasizing a sleeker silhouette. For those seeking a more flattering fit, consider opting for jackets with peak lapels, as they can elongate the body and draw the eye upwards.
What is the Difference Between a Double-Breasted Jacket and a Regular Jacket?
The primary distinction lies in the button arrangement and lapel design. Double-breasted jackets feature a wider, more pronounced lapel and a double row of parallel buttons, creating a more formal and distinguished look. In contrast, regular jackets typically have a single row of buttons and a narrower lapel, offering a more versatile and casual appearance.

What Body Type Should Wear Double-Breasted Jackets?
Double-breasted jackets can complement various body types, particularly when tailored to enhance one's proportions. Individuals with an athletic or rectangular shape can benefit from the added definition to the waist, while those with an inverted triangle shape might appreciate how it balances their broader shoulders. Ultimately, choosing the right jacket involves considering both fit and personal style.

Can Double-Breasted Jackets be Worn Unbuttoned?
Yes, wearing a double-breasted jacket unbuttoned can offer a relaxed yet chic look, ideal for less formal settings. This style allows for more movement and flexibility, making it a popular choice for casual or creative environments. However, ensure the jacket fits well even when unbuttoned to maintain a polished appearance.
